Resumen

The circular economy has become a topic of increasing relevance in the scientific field, and the literature on it has developed considerably in recent years. Therefore, a review is needed to contribute to the understanding of this term, which is under constant debate. This article aims to analyze scientific articles from qualitative and quantitative research approaches on the circular economy. The methodology used was a systematic review of scientific literature from Scopus and Web of Science; 67 scientific articles were systematized under inclusion and exclusion criteria related to the specific objectives sought. The results showed that there is still a long way to go in developing a theoretical framework that can be put into practice due to the divergence of existing perspectives or approaches, although its application to different fields of study is being considered. Likewise, its complex character is highlighted, while driving or limiting factors are observed. This research provides a theoretical contribution aimed at elucidating which implications of the circular economy need to be addressed in order to build a universal or flexible theory to understand what it means to plan for the implementation of the circular economy. In this way, it hopes to strengthen its practical application, which implies the need to create an overarching framework that can be adapted to different contexts and provide clear guidance on how to be part of the circular economy.
